WebApr 25, 2024 · High taxes are a weak point for real estate investment in Malaysia. The rental income tax here is a flat rate of 20% for residents. And taxes are 25% if you are not a resident of the country. The real estate gains tax (RPGT) payable on any gains made on the sale of real estate is also very high if you have owned the property for less than half ... WebNov 29, 2024 · Malaysia is one of the most open economies in the world with a trade to GDP ratio averaging over 130% since 2010. Openness to trade and investment has been instrumental in employment creation and income growth, with about 40% of jobs in Malaysia linked to export activities.
